What's The Definition Of Rhyolite?

rhyolite in American English
a light-colored igneous rock with a fine-grained, granitelike texture
noun: a fine-grained igneous rock rich in silica: the volcanic equivalent of granite

rhyolite in British English
noun: a fine-grained igneous rock consisting of quartz, feldspars, and mica or amphibole. It is the volcanic equivalent of granite
